NYFW 2012: Victoria Beckham

Dear readers,

Victoria Beckham is pretty new in the fashion industry, but from the moment she introduced her first collection she has been carefully watched, because the fashion industry knew she was up and coming! Now, let's see what her Spring/Summer 2013 collection looks like!












So, what do you say about Ms. Beckham's collection? We see a lot of red, white and black and the thing that distinguishes her collection and show from many others is the fact that not one model was wearing high heels! I love that!
My favourite item of the collection? The long red blazer! What a statement piece!
